# tcgen
Yet another test case generator (But hopefully better)

Quickly and painlessly generate testcases with a minimal amount of code

# Installation

```bash
python3.7 -m pip install cp-tcgen
```

# Capabilities

tcgen creates several endpoints to generate data with several different methods

# Examples
https://dmoj.ca/problem/dpa

```python
from tcgen import *
# Bounds are 1..1e5 by default
N = Integer(2, 100000)
print(N)
print(Array(N, Integer(10000)))
```

https://dmoj.ca/problem/dpb
```python
from tcgen import *
class Gen(Generator):
    def generate(self, case_num):
        N = Integer(L=2, wcnt=20)  # Weighted random
        K = Integer(100)
        self.p(N, K)
        self.p(Array(N, U=10000))

gen = Gen()
print(gen.get_test_cases(10))
print(gen.get_test_case())
```
